Output de267947535e7860c8abb90d290fc2d376d1419bf666011f6271911314cb118e:2

value
700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b95547c262143cc05889ecfb3aac6abbcf0db08 OP_EQUALVERIFY OP_CHECKSIG
address
1J6rFWEDxA9xnyS6xhnwy1yAk1UbhFCDwu
transaction
de267947535e7860c8abb90d290fc2d376d1419bf666011f6271911314cb118e
spent
true